Advantages
High resolution
Optimizing electric sector size and electrode arrangement density suppresses field distortion, yielding resolution above 99 across the m/z range of 2-50 Da.
High transmission
Ion detection efficiency exceeds 92% across the mass range, indicating minimal ion loss and reduced sample demand.
Sharp peaks for light ions
For light ions such as H₂⁺ and He⁺, the FWHM is approximately 0.03 Da, enabling clear separation of closely spaced masses.
Acceptable peaks for heavy ions
For heavier ions like Ar⁺ and CO₂⁺, the FWHM is about 0.40 Da, still providing adequate mass separation.
